Elegant Lombard trumeau from the mid-20th century. Double-bodied cabinet in Barocchetto style carved in walnut, ebonised wood and fruitwood. Trumeau for a salon or study fitted with three drawers and a calatoia in the lower body. Flap with four small drawers inside, a central document compartment and a good-sized writing tabletop and service (see photo). Upper body complete with two small pull-out shelves for candles and two doors with antiqued recessed glass (see photo). Interior fitted with two small shelves plus base shelf. Cabinet complete with one working key (upper body), flap key missing. Trumeau for antique dealers and interior decorators, supported at the front by two curly feet (see photo). Shows some signs of time, overall in good state of preservation.
